Kienböck’s disease is a relatively uncommon condition that affects the lunate, a small, crescent-shaped bone in the wrist. The condition develops when the blood supply to the lunate is disrupted, usually due to an injury or inflammation. This causes the bone to gradually break down, eventually leading to arthritis of the wrist.

Kienböck’s disease does not always cause symptoms; sometimes, the condition is identified during a diagnostic examination performed for an unrelated reason. When to See Our Hand & Wrist Specialist

In general, we suggest that you seek professional medical attention if you notice:

  • A dull ache in your wrist that comes and goes
  • Consistent, sharp wrist pain
  • Swelling or stiffness in your hand or wrist
  • Creaking, crackling, or grating sounds when you move your wrist
  • A decreased range of motion in your wrist
  • A weakened grip

Although there is no single cure for Kienböck’s disease, treatment can help restore blood flow to the lunate, relieve pain, improve function, and slow or stop the condition from progressing. These goals may be accomplished with a combination of rest, casting, physical therapy, and/or medications. To address severe symptoms, we might suggest a surgical procedure, such as joint leveling, revascularization of the lunate, or a wrist fusion.
